LC-MS is Employed in proteomics as a technique to detect and discover the factors of a fancy mixture. The bottom-up proteomics LC-MS solution typically involves protease digestion and denaturation working with trypsin as a protease, urea to denature the tertiary composition, and iodoacetamide to change the cysteine residues. Right after digestion, LC-MS is used for peptide mass fingerprinting, or LC-MS/MS (tandem MS) is used to derive the sequences of particular person peptides.[31] LC-MS/MS is most commonly utilized for proteomic analysis of complex samples exactly where peptide masses may well overlap even with a substantial-resolution mass spectrometry.

Some time at which a selected analyte emerges in the column is termed as its retention time. The retention time is calculated less than particular situations and considered as the determining characteristic of the given analyte.

In other resources, the droplets are drawn by way of a heated capillary tube since they enter the vacuum, selling droplet evaporation and ion emission. These methods of increasing droplet evaporation now enable the usage of liquid stream prices of one - two mL/min to be used while however accomplishing economical ionisation[26] and significant sensitivity. Consequently though the get more info use of 1 - three mm microbore columns and lower move costs of fifty - two hundred μl/min was usually regarded needed for ideal Procedure, this limitation is no more as vital, and the upper column capacity of more substantial bore columns can now be advantageously employed with ESI LC-MS systems. Positively and negatively billed ions could be established by switching polarities, and it is achievable to acquire alternate constructive and adverse manner spectra speedily throughout the very same LC run .
